Seek uses image recognition technology to identify plants, animals, and fungi you encounter. It helps you learn about the organisms around you by providing information based on millions of wildlife observations. You can also earn badges for making different types of observations and participating in challenges.
Simply open the Seek Camera within the app and point it at living things you want to identify. The app will then use its image recognition capabilities to suggest what the organism might be. You can add species to your observations and learn more about them.
